The Best Ghost Stories Of Algernon Blackwood by Algernon Blackwood
Selected from the entire body of Algernon Blackwood’s work, this collection contains some of his finest writing. Blackwood’s ability to create and sustain an atmosphere of unrelieved horror is witnessed in ‘The Willows’, a starkly terrifying tale of another dimension impinging on our own. In contrast, ‘The Other Wing’, is a chilling but delicate evocation of the mysteries of childhood. Mysticism and cosmic experiences feature, as well as the more traditional elements of the horror story. Best Ghost Stories of Algernon Blackwood reveals why Blackwood is celebrated as the twentieth century’s foremost British writer of supernatural fiction.
